Inhibidores del Receptor de Glutamato son compuestos que bloquean la actividad de los receptores de glutamato, los principales receptores de neurotransmisores excitatorios en el cerebro. Estos receptores desempeñan un papel crucial en la transmisión sináptica, la plasticidad, el aprendizaje y la memoria. La desregulación de la señalización de glutamato está asociada con varios trastornos neurológicos, como la epilepsia, el accidente cerebrovascular y las enfermedades neurodegenerativas. Los inhibidores de los receptores de glutamato son esenciales para investigar los mecanismos de la excitotoxicidad y desarrollar estrategias neuroprotectoras.
